Online presence includes not only a website, but so much more. Gone are the days when a business owner goes through the yellow pages and finds one of the thousands of graphic designers and programmers who market themselves as a web developer. An online presence is a key part of your marketing today and a good majority of them do not understand marketing at all. You might get a great looking website that does absolutely nothing for you or could get a great database engine backend and never have your site found.
The key to your success will be to have a detailed online presence plan that provides each web company with your requirements now and in the future. It will let the web company know who your target market is, what type of online presence you need, what type of integration you need with the different pieces or systems you have, corporate branding and the look you require, the type of website content you require, if you want to update website content yourself or have someone else do it, how you plan to capture leads, your budget, and much more. This will narrow down the companies who can work with you on all of the pieces of your online presence and will also provide a way to document against the actual delivery if there is any question once complete. If you are just going to a web company and telling them you need a website and giving them a budget, then you are allowing someone who knows nothing about your company and your goals to create your online presence and you will not get the results you expected.
Once you have all the pieces of your online presence, it is important that each piece helps drive traffic to the other pieces. If you have a Facebook or Twitter page and are not using the linkages available to drive traffic to and from your website, you are missing an opportunity.
